- Examination of The Status and Continuous Anxiety Levels of Swimmers Aged 11-12

Abstract :In the study, it was aimed to examine the state anxiety and trait anxiety levels of swimmers aged 11-12 according to various variables. The research was carried out in the general scanning model. The universe of the research consists of 321 swimmers who participated in the 11-12 age group regional competitions organized by the Turkish Swimming Federation. The sample consists of 217 (113 boys, 104 girls) swimmers participating in these competitions. The State and Trait Anxiety Scale (STAS), developed by Spielberg (1976) and adapted into Turkish by Öner and Le Compte (1983), was used as a scale. SPSS program was used in the analysis of the data. Since it was seen that the data fulfilled the parametric assumptions, t test, One-Way Anova test, Scheffe test and Pearson correlation coefficient were used in the analysis. According to the gender variable, it was determined that the state anxiety levels of male swimmers were higher than that of female swimmers. It was determined that there was no statistical difference in trait and state anxiety levels according to family monthly income and age variables. According to the swimming age variable, the trait anxiety levels of the athletes with a swimming age of 6 years and above were lower than the swimmers with a swimming age of 1 month-1 year and 4-5 years. It was determined that the trait anxiety levels of swimmers whose mothers and fathers graduated from primary education were higher than those who graduated from higher education. After all, It was revealed that the trait anxiety levels of the swimmers included in the study were higher than their state anxiety levels, and there was an inverse relationship between state and trait anxiety levels.Keywords : Kaygı, Durum kaygı, Sürekli kaygı, Yüzücü, Kaygı düzeyi
